Recovery Community Organiser - Prisons (& Tutor/Assessor)

Integrated Commissioning Unit

Another pilot project, this role was built on the success of the previous Development Worker position. Using the same premise, I took a recovery focused model into HMP Winchester to work directly with Portsmouth IOM clients, who were not engaging well with the IOM scheme or treatment services. This was a hugely challenging, yet rewarding role. I set up and ran three successful SMART Recovery groups, 2 in HMP Winchester and 1 in HMP Westhill. Needing to liaise with Governors, Prison Officers, in-house Probation and the guys who attended the groups, the role required excellent communication and relationship building skills. Outside the prison, I liaised with IOM, the Police and Probation, the local service user group and treatment services. The role required further support, and a p/t worker was employed to support the project as it grew.Having established this project successfully, it was then commissioned to a provider, The Society of St. James, who continue this work to this date.

Mar 2012 - Dec 2013

Service Development Worker (& Tutor/Assessor)

Integrated Commissioning Unit

This role was a pilot project borne out of the idea that, maybe clients are not "hard to reach" or "difficult to engage", but rather that they were disillusioned with the current system. Clients were trapped in a cycle of prison, hostels and homelessness. So, we took the work to them.Using SMART Recovery, we took the recovery conversation into the local hostels and worked with clients that were not engaging. We incentivised group attendance inline with NICE guidelines on Contingency Management. The role consisted of liaising with SMART Recovery UK to develop a SMART Partnership programme with local service providers. As such, I became the Commissioning-level SMART Champion for the city. Groups were started in three different hostels whilst interest in the model was further developed in the community. So called " difficult to engage" clients did engage and we achieved many successful outcomes, with clients re-engaging with treatment services and moving on into more suitable accommodation. This also resulted in lower rates of criminality. This success paved the way for an expansion of role, taking the same model into the local allocations prison. (See Recovery Community Organiser role)
